The aim of the course is to introduce basic phrases and language for use in common real life situations.Typical topics covered at Stage 1 may include: greetings, giving personal and family information; ordering food and drink; shopping for food and clothes. Different topics are covered each term. Sessions are lively and varied with goals tailored to individual needs. The emphasis is on speaking and listening, with pair and group activities to maximise opportunities to speak in the language.
